Our first year

A note from our Trustees

2020-21 was a difficult and challenging year for all communities across Milton Keynes with the pandemic affecting fundamental areas of life including the ability to play sport freely. Lockdown meant all physical activities across every level, both competitively and socially, were curtailed.

With restrictions hitting hard we still managed to launch our first programme during Christmas 2020 where we organised an online activity day for children from the women’s refuge run by MK Act. The smiles on their faces and appreciation from their parents was a highlight and brought a sense of hope and optimism.

Finally in March 2021 we began to see a relaxation of lockdown rules allowing 5 On It Foundation to organise and promote a free sport programme with the help of a £1000 donation from our patron John Baldwin and funding from the Milton Keynes Community Foundation.

Its aim was to provide free tennis for those living within ow socio economic conditions with an emphasis on the BAMER community. Having had to postpone it twice due to the pandemic, it really was third time lucky! The four week Saturday project attracted over 70 young people, many of whom had not had the chance to pick up a racket. We received great coverage from the local media and fantastic feedback from parents, it was a huge success and at last we were off the starting block!

We are immensely proud of what we have achieved, despite the difficulties faced with the pandemic, and are so excited to have built partnerships with amazing local organisations. Our belief and commitment to bringing physical activity and art programmes to the community has never been stronger and we are filled with confidence as we stride with purpose into 2022.

Bursary Programme

John Baldwin Bursary Programme

In June we were delighted to announce the launch of our new bursary scheme to provide a pathway to those who take part in our sports and arts programmes. Its primary focus is to help those who, owing to financial constraints within their family, would not have the opportunity to progress in a sports or arts activity discovered through one of our projects.

This exciting initiative could not have been launched without further financial support from our patron John Baldwin who, inspired by his beautiful late wife Sylvia, has a passion for helping those who need it most . We are therefore delighted to name it the John Baldwin Bursary Programme.
